Vick’s Sentence Shows America's Racist Ways

New America Media, Commentary, Charles Jones, Posted: Dec 11, 2007

Editor’s Note: Atlanta Falcon’s quarterback Michael Vick was sentenced to two years in prison for running a dogfighting ring out of his home and some dog-lovers are up in arms over – what they say – is not enough time. But New America Media commentator Charles Jones says that the reaction of some Americans to the Vick case gives away their contradictory views regarding black men.

Michael Vick doesn’t deserve the almost two years the Feds slapped on him this week for fighting and killing pit bulls. But he was lucky to get 23 months – it’s not the five or six years I thought he would get. I’m sure that Michael Vick is as close to elated as possible, under the circumstances.

With Vick’s sentencing out of the way, maybe his critics can back off and stop couch quarterbacking his legal proceedings. If there is any good luck Vick has had over this past year, it’s that the dog-loving world isn’t his judge and jury. If they were, he would have been lucky to get off with the legal maximum.

When I checked out comments responding to an article about his sentencing, I wasn’t surprised to see the PETA (People for Ethical Treatment of Animals) crowd disgruntled about how “short” his prison term is. I wasn’t even surprised to see the number of people who actually equate the value of a dog’s life to that of a human. People who seriously feel that Vick should be executed or banned from pro-football for life just rub me the wrong way – especially because a lot of what I’ve heard in the media concerning this case has racist undertones.

Black people have a history in this country of having our lives valued at less than those of dogs. We were only 3/5th human after all.

I know, some of you are thinking: “Race-card! Race-card! Out of context!”

But, consider this contradiction: Vick and co. were fighting pit bulls – a breed that has been deemed so vicious that mainstream America is increasingly working toward eradicating them. Cities like San Francisco have adopted strict neutering and euthanization laws for these dogs. Mainstream America hates, fears and mistrusts pit bulls damn near as much as they do young African Americans like Michael Vick.

Maybe that’s why the hood loves pit bulls so much. Maybe it’s that they are as feared and mistrusted by mainstream society as we are – and they make people think twice about robbing your house.

My neighbor is a 10-year PETA member. This neighbor not only stays away from pit bulls, but even complained (and exaggerated) to my landlord that a “vicious dog” was roaming the complex when I allowed my two-year-old daughter to play outside our apartment with a friend’s two-and-a-half-month-old pit bull puppy. My landlord freaked, the puppy was banned from the property and I was threatened with eviction if he was ever seen within our gates again. I have personal experience with how people deal with pit bulls.

So to feign this care for all dogs and fake like the fact that Vick is black has nothing to do with the public vitriol that surrounds him is just dog doo-doo. Michael Vick is in prison where men and women all over this country are beaten, raped and stabbed daily. And he’ll be there for at least two years. To say that he deserves a murder sentence because he abused or even killed a few dogs belonging to a breed that the powers that be would like to kill off, is ludicrous and shows how very little a young black male’s life means to America at the subconscious core of her being.
